Notes: Begins with delicate, breathy falsetto in isolation, then transitions into layered vocals with distorted screaming and chaotic percussion loops. The dramatic shift from solitude to communal chaos creates an emotionally overwhelming sensory experience.

A two-part emotional journey from melancholic falsetto vulnerability to cathartic vocal intensity with layered percussion.
